Pro-life Display Destroyed at Washington University - Vandal Arrested
By John-Henry Westen
BELLINGHAM, WA, May 3, 2006 (LifeSiteNews.com) - A Western Washington University pro-life club's display was virtually destroyed by yesterday afternoon by a bare-foot male student who was photographed and videotaped as he dismantled the display. After spending more than three hours playing his guitar and observing the campus-approved display, the Asian male began to tape newspapers over one of the perimeter signs that warned students they were approaching the display.
The student was then observed leaping over the perimeter barricade that surrounded the display. Pro-life students, out of respect for his person, did not physically interfere as the vandal proceeded to systematically tear down the entire display. Their first concern was for the safety of several small children inside the display area who were quickly moved to safety.

At one point the student picked up one of the plastic pipes used for framework and hurled through one of the signs later ripping the large poster to shreds and proceeding to destroy the next sign. When he had completed his destruction, the young man left the enclosure and rejoined a handful of pro-abortion supporters who had gathered to cheer him on. The group embraced the young

man and greeted him with cheers and applause.
The incident was captured on film by numerous security cameras. Campus police were called and as soon as the sirens could be heard, the young man immediately ran into one of the campus buildings. He was followed through the building and exited out the back where he was observed heading into the forested surroundings. Campus police arrived within minutes and several constables pursued him into the heavy bush. Within thirty minutes they had captured him and he was escorted to the police station. Charges are pending but police indicated that he faces felony charges as well as campus disciplinary action.
John Hof, President of Campaign Life Coalition BC who was present for the display complimented the pro-life students for their calm demeanour during this assault on their campus freedoms. "Not one student raised their voice or their hands as this whole incident transpired," Hof told LifeSiteNews.com. "In fact the destruction of the display lead many more students to engage the pro-lifers in discussion. They certainly gained the sympathy of onlookers and passers-by as they quietly attempted to repair the damage done and re-erect the display as best they could."
Preliminary estimates indicated the damage done could reach as high as several thousand dollars. Organizers said they had permission from campus administration for a two-day display and promised to return for their second day today.
